SURFACE EMPHASIS WITH PURPOSE

Use UV Coating to Control What Customers Notice

A box can contain strong artwork and still feel visually unfocused when every element competes for attention. UV coating should help create order. It can reinforce a brand mark, product name, graphic, border, pattern, or selected panel while allowing supporting information to remain clear. Raised UV can add greater visual and tactile weight where the approved design calls for it. Matte, gloss, soft-touch, foil, embossing, debossing, and other supported treatments should be coordinated around the same objective: helping the surface communicate the intended character without becoming overloaded.

  • Emboss Deboss
    Set the Overall Surface Mood

    Matte or soft-touch treatment can support a quieter, more considered background, while gloss can suit brighter or more energetic artwork. UV emphasis can then be positioned around the visual cues that deserve greater importance.

  • Sport UV
    Give Important Details More Weight

    Spot UV, raised UV, foil, embossing, or debossing can bring selected brand and product elements forward. The purpose is to establish a clear viewing order—not to apply every available treatment to every panel.

  • Lamination
    Distinguish Editions Without Losing the Brand

    Launches, seasonal collections, gift ranges, and limited editions can use changes in UV placement or supporting finishes to feel distinct while retaining recognizable parent-brand colors, typography, and layout principles.

  3. details content icon 1785233336
    Plan Printing and UV Placement Together

    UV coating should be considered while the artwork is being organized, not added after every panel is already crowded. Begin by deciding which information must remain easy to read and which element should receive greater visual importance. Available printing routes include digital, offset, flexographic, CMYK, PMS or spot colors, metallic ink, and white ink on kraft. Printing can be planned for the front, back, top, bottom, outside, and inside where relevant. UV treatment may also be coordinated with matte, gloss, soft-touch, foil, embossing, debossing, and raised effects, subject to the approved material, structure, and production specification.
